The Architecture of Fan Devotion
People do not fall in love with algorithms. They fall in love with specific moments. A laugh shared during a live interview. A candid interview where a star stumbles over words. These micro-moments build emotional equity. Fans remember the awkward pauses more than the scripted promos.
Authenticity Over Polish
Audiences smell artificiality from miles away. A beloved celebrity often embraces visible imperfection. They admit failures. They share unguarded opinions. This creates a parasocial bond that feels like friendship, not fandom.
Consistency in Character
The entertainment industry churns out new names every week. Sustaining attention requires more than a viral clip. It demands a steady personality over years of work. When a star changes their values for every trend, the connection frays.
The Long Game of Trust
Trust is a fragile asset. Once a beloved celebrity breaks that trust, the audience rarely forgives them. They forgive mistakes. They do not forgive hypocrisy. Staying grounded off-camera matters more than the on-screen persona.
Shared Values and Community
Fans do not just consume content. They join tribes. A beloved celebrity often represents a shared identity. They voice the unspoken frustrations of a specific group. This creates a protective instinct among supporters.
The Role of Philanthropy
Charitable work adds another layer of sincerity. When a star uses their platform for quiet impact, it resonates. Loud announcements often backfire. Tangible, long-term support speaks volumes. The Power of Relatable Struggle
Everyone faces personal storms. A beloved celebrity who shares their own battles earns deep respect. Mental health struggles. Financial setbacks. Family conflicts. These admissions strip away the untouchable aura. They make the star feel human again.
Why Vulnerability Sells
Vulnerability does not equal weakness. It equals courage. When a performer exposes their flaws, the audience exhales. They realize their own imperfections are normal. That shared humanity keeps the connection alive through decades.
